In Altamont, common issues include electrical system problems, such as with power windows or door locks, and suspension wear from our rural roads. Many Hyundai models, like the Sonata and Elantra, also experience premature brake wear, which is important to monitor given the mix of highway and gravel road driving common here.
Look for shops with ASE-certified technicians who have specific Hyundai or Korean-brand experience. In our area, checking with local community groups on social media or asking for long-standing reputations at family-owned garages can be very reliable, as word-of-mouth is strong in a smaller community like Altamont.
For most routine maintenance and non-warranty repairs, a trusted local independent shop in Altamont can provide more personalized service and often better value. However, for complex computer/software issues, major recalls, or work covered under an active factory warranty, you may need to visit the nearest Hyundai dealership, which is located in Effingham or Mattoon.
Labor rates in Altamont are typically more competitive than in major metro areas, which can lower overall costs. However, for certain specialized Hyundai parts, there might be a slight delay or shipping cost, so it's wise to ask your local mechanic about parts availability and sourcing to avoid surprises.
Our Illinois winters with road salt and seasonal temperature extremes accelerate corrosion and battery wear. It's crucial to have undercarriage inspections and battery tests performed locally before winter. Furthermore, frequent short trips common in a small town can lead to moisture buildup in the oil, making regular oil changes at a local shop even more important.
